Café Rose is a monochromatic color palette tagged coffee, muted, warm. All four colors sit within 4° of hue, so the scheme reads as one color explored across light and dark. Neither washed out nor loud, it adapts to most contexts. The overall temperature is warm.

Why it works and how to use it

It works because the lightness range is wide (21% to 97%), which gives clear hierarchy between background, content and accents. Try it for websites, presentations and branding.

  • Background: Smoke (#FBF4F2) is the lightest color, so it belongs on large surfaces.
  • Text: Jet (#3F2B2B) on #FBF4F2 gives 12.14:1, passing WCAG AAA.
  • Primary: Melon (#F2B8B5) is the most saturated mid-tone; use it for buttons and links with a border or a darker shade for contrast.
  • Accent: Cocoa (#8A5F5C) for highlights, badges and hover states.

3 of 6 color pairs pass WCAG AA (4.5:1); the strongest is Jet on Smoke at 12.14:1.
